[Remote] Key Account Manager - Power Distribution

Work from home Full-time role Hiring

Note: The job is a remote job and is open to candidates in USA. HellermannTyton North America is seeking a Key Account Manager for their Power Distribution market. The role focuses on driving strategic development and sales growth by building strong client relationships and executing targeted sales strategies for opportunities and accounts.

Responsibilities

  • Accelerate revenue growth through the development of larger-scale market-specific accounts and opportunities
  • Specify HellermannTyton wire management and identification solutions with a goal of maximizing HellermannTyton content with new customers and applications
  • Build a cohesive strategy with other HellermannTyton salespeople, ensuring a uniform strategy across the customer enterprise
  • Drive, manage, and close multiple project opportunities across a broad customer base
  • Development and execution of market-based pricing strategies
  • Proactively communicates opportunity milestones and changes to strategies across all relevant stakeholder groups
  • Contribute to marketing content as requested
  • Other duties as assigned

Skills

  • Bachelor's degree preferred. MBA or other advanced degree is a plus
  • Minimum of 5 years of experience in manufacturing or designing power distribution equipment. Power distribution equipment includes, but is not limited to: Low Voltage Switchgear, Medium Voltage Switchgear, Uninterruptible Power Systems (UPS), Static Transfer Switches, Automatic Transfer Switches, and Power Distribution Units (PDUs)
  • Proficient at reading and working with engineering drawings
  • Ability to travel up to 50% of the time
  • Must have a valid driver's license, acceptable driving record, and adequate insurance
  • Customer Focus – Demonstrated ability to form meaningful partnerships (internal/external) at all organizational levels, resulting in meaningful solutions to complex problems
  • Strategic Vision – The ability to see the big picture, contribute to the HellermannTyton strategic plan, align, develop, and execute customer strategic plans
  • Sales skills/knowledge - Proven experience specifying components with customers and experience applying a program/platform/model year approach to gaining sales
  • Technical Capabilities - Ability to understand plastics, materials, and the benefits of different plastic fasteners, as well as to understand wire and component labeling opportunities. Excellent Computer proficiency in Microsoft Office and CRM systems
  • Communication / Interpersonal – Ability to influence and collaborate cross-functionally (e.g., engineering, supply chain, marketing, finance, etc.) at all levels
  • Excellent verbal and Written Communication Skills - including the ability to recognize and customize communications to different audiences, including utilizing diverse information from a variety of sources to present the HellermannTyton value proposition in an effective manner. Persistent yet reasonable approach to communicating and driving results. Ability to utilize and leverage relevant social media platforms, trade organizations, etc., to penetrate and expand business opportunities
  • Leadership - Foster a team atmosphere and lead people through influence who are not direct reports
  • Results-Oriented - Must be effective at both directly closing sales opportunities and presenting opportunities for local sales teams to develop and close. Demonstrated detail orientation and disciplined time management to drive multiple activities to the established timelines
  • Continuous Improvement - Change agent for internal process improvements
  • Experience working with electrical harnessing, routing, or electrical design preferred
  • Polished presentation skills, with a sincere demeanor
  • Proven ability to effectively interact with all levels within a customer organization

Company Overview

  • HellermannTyton is a global leader in cable management and protection products and identification systems. It was founded in 1969, and is headquartered in Milwaukee, WI, US, with a workforce of 501-1000 employees. Its website is https://www.hellermanntyton.us/.
